These are some photos from our daytrip to Shenandoah National Park. When we first arrived in the park we saw some fog and low lying clouds over the mountains. We still had some nice views of the valley and river. We took our favorite walk on the Limberlost trail and we saw a Black Bear in a tree near the Big Meadows campstore parking lot.
